Artistic Director (15%): Artistic directors lead the creative vision and strategic planning for arts organizations, such as theaters, galleries, and festivals.
They oversee programming, production, and artistic staff, ensuring high-quality artistic experiences. 2. Exhibition Coordinator (20%): Exhibition coordinators manage the planning, execution, and delivery of art exhibitions.
They collaborate with artists, curators, and other stakeholders to ensure a seamless and engaging experience for visitors. 3. Festival Curator (10%): Festival curators design and implement creative programming for arts festivals.
They research, select, and coordinate artists, exhibitions, and events, aiming to deliver diverse, innovative, and thought-provoking experiences to the public. 4. Artistic Collaborator (30%): Artistic collaborators work closely with artists, art directors, and curators to develop and execute creative projects.
They contribute their skills and expertise to various aspects of the artistic process, from concept development to final production. 5. Cultural Program Manager (25%): Cultural program managers design, develop, and implement cultural events and initiatives, often in collaboration with artists, community organizations, and other stakeholders.
They ensure the successful execution of these programs, promoting access, education, and engagement in the arts.
